I’ve always been fascinated by the concept of the butterfly effect. It’s a concept in chaos theory that says that changes in an environment, no matter how small, can have a big impact. The classic example is that a single flap of a butterfly’s wings could possibly determine whether or not a hurricane would form miles away weeks later. While weather is probably not that sensitive to change, I think the idea is interesting. How much could small decisions and tiny changes in behavior change where we end up in our life?
